#Chapter 222: Over the Balcony
Moana
I decided that I couldn’t let Edrick go on for any longer without telling Ella the truth about her biological mother.
“I know that you didn’t tell her everything,” I said as I stood in front of him with my hands on my hips. He was standing in front of the bathroom sink in his bedroom and was brushing his teeth. With a sigh, he slowly spit out his toothpaste and then looked over at me.
“What do you mean?” he asked. I could tell that he was trying to play it off like he didn’t know what I was thinking about.
A frown came across my face. “Don’t play dumb. I know that you didn’t tell Ella about her mother even though we talked about it. Are you going to tell her the truth, or do I need to? Because the longer she goes without knowing everything, the more she’ll resent you when she eventually does find out.”
